aboutsummaryrefslogtreecommitdiff
path: root/benchtests/json-lib.c
diff options
context:
space:
mode:
authorH.J. Lu <hjl.tools@gmail.com>2024-12-17 05:54:19 +0800
committerH.J. Lu <hjl.tools@gmail.com>2024-12-18 01:54:26 +0800
commitd4ee46b0cd43012d311e07f11ee960efec3f1a94 (patch)
treea1dfa9909d3a67e143b51b7589f690da983b3e12 /benchtests/json-lib.c
parent560cfeb82693912723ff0e11232c86f9b492a1a0 (diff)
downloadglibc-d4ee46b0cd43012d311e07f11ee960efec3f1a94.zip
glibc-d4ee46b0cd43012d311e07f11ee960efec3f1a94.tar.gz
glibc-d4ee46b0cd43012d311e07f11ee960efec3f1a94.tar.bz2
tst-clone3[-internal].c: Add _Atomic to silence Clang
Add _Atomic to futex_wait argument and ctid in tst-clone3[-internal].c to silence Clang error: ../sysdeps/unix/sysv/linux/tst-clone3-internal.c:93:3: error: address argument to atomic operation must be a pointer to _Atomic type ('pid_t *' (aka 'int *') invalid) 93 | wait_tid (&ctid, CTID_INIT_VAL); | ^ ~~~~~ ../sysdeps/unix/sysv/linux/tst-clone3-internal.c:51:21: note: expanded from macro 'wait_tid' 51 | while ((__tid = atomic_load_explicit (ctid_ptr, \ | ^ ~~~~~~~~ /usr/bin/../lib/clang/19/include/stdatomic.h:145:30: note: expanded from macro 'atomic_load_explicit' 145 | #define atomic_load_explicit __c11_atomic_load | ^ Signed-off-by: H.J. Lu <hjl.tools@gmail.com> Reviewed-by: Sam James <sam@gentoo.org>
Diffstat (limited to 'benchtests/json-lib.c')
0 files changed, 0 insertions, 0 deletions